St. Patrick Newsletter

The parish newsletter was one of the first major items discussed by the stewardship committee.  The committee agreed upon a quarterly communication that would be sent to all registered families; thus, our newsletter -- St. Pat's Today -- was begun.  The first issue was mailed March 17, 2001; the fourth issue will be mailed in early December.

The newsletter is intended to inform parishioners about ongoing events within the parish, as well as to provide features of interest about parish history, staff, ministries and other articles that may build a sense of community within the parish.

Rich McAdams is the editor of St. Pat's Today with a staff of five working with him, along with two staff editors.  The preparation is handled in a very professional manner.  A month prior to the mailing, the staff meets to discuss topics for the issue.  Rich says there are always more topics than available space.  Staff members can volunteer to write specific articles, or subjects can be assigned according to the interest of writers.  

Articles are due within three weeks from assignment.  After editing, the information is inserted into the Publisher software program and edited again.  The printer, a member of St. Pat's parish, has the issue ready in a week.  At this point, another group of volunteers prepare the newsletter for mailing and take it to the Kennett Square post office.  Most parishioners have their copy within two days of mailing.
